Local Culture
Minnesota is known for its friendly people, delicious food, and unique traditions. One of the most popular cultural events is the Minnesota State Fair, which takes place every August and features everything from live music to deep-fried foods.
Minnesota Nice
One of the things that sets Minnesota apart is the concept of "Minnesota Nice." This refers to the state's reputation for being friendly, welcoming, and polite. Visitors to Minnesota often remark on how kind and helpful the locals are, making it a wonderful place to visit.

Boundary Waters Canoe Area Wilderness
The Boundary Waters Canoe Area Wilderness is a must-see destination for anyone who loves the great outdoors. This pristine wilderness area covers more than a million acres and features over 1,000 lakes and streams. Visitors can hike, camp, and canoe in this breathtakingly beautiful area.
Question or Answer
Q: What is the best time of year to visit Minnesota?
A: The best time to visit Minnesota depends on what you're looking for. If you want to experience the state's famous fall colors, September and October are the best months to visit. If you're looking for outdoor activities like hiking and fishing, summer is the best time to visit. And if you want to experience the famous Minnesota State Fair, plan your trip for late August.
Q: What are some of the best restaurants in Minnesota?
A: Minnesota is known for its delicious food, and there are plenty of great restaurants to choose from. Some of the most popular include Spoon and Stable in Minneapolis, The Bachelor Farmer in Minneapolis, and The Lexington in St. Paul.
Q: What are some fun things to do in Minnesota with kids?
A: Minnesota is a great destination for families, with plenty of activities that kids will love. Some of the best places to visit include the Minnesota Zoo, Valleyfair amusement park, and the Science Museum of Minnesota.
Q: What are some of the most beautiful natural attractions in Minnesota?
A: Minnesota is full of natural beauty, from the North Shore to the Boundary Waters Canoe Area Wilderness. Some other must-see natural attractions include Minnehaha Falls, Gooseberry Falls State Park, and the Mississippi River Headwaters.
